Vitamin D3 and Nutritional Supplements: An Essential Route to Optimize Your Health

Vitamin D3, chemically known as cholecalciferol, is recognized as a vital nutrient necessary for numerous biological functions. Unlike other vitamins, vitamin D3 is unique because the body can synthesize it naturally upon exposure to sunlight, particularly UVB rays. However, factors such as geographic location, skin pigmentation, age, and lifestyle can significantly influence this process, often leading to insufficient vitamin D3 levels in many populations.

Given these limitations, supplementation has become a crucial approach to ensuring optimal vitamin D3 status. Supplementation offers a controlled, reliable source of this nutrient, capable of bridging the gap caused by limited sun exposure or dietary insufficiency. It allows precise dosing, ensuring consistent intake tailored to individual needs, thus supporting overall health and longevity.

Effective vitamin D3 supplements are available in various forms, including capsules, soft gels, liquids, and sublingual tablets. The most common and well-researched form is vitamin D3 (cholecalciferol), which is preferred over D2 (ergocalciferol) due to its higher potency and longer-lasting effects. When choosing a supplement, quality and bioavailability are critical. High-quality products undergo rigorous testing, ensuring purity and safety.

Maintaining blood levels of vitamin D3 within a recommended range—generally between 30 to 50 ng/mL—is associated with numerous health benefits. Supplementation dosages vary depending on age, weight, health status, and lifestyle factors. For many, daily doses range from 800 IU to 4,000 IU, but some individuals may require higher amounts as determined by healthcare providers. Regular monitoring through blood tests ensures safety and maximizes benefits, avoiding toxicity while achieving optimal levels.

To optimize efficacy, it’s advisable to pair vitamin D3 supplements with other supporting nutrients. For instance, vitamin K2 is known to work synergistically with vitamin D3, directing calcium to bones and preventing arterial calcification. Magnesium plays a pivotal role in activating vitamin D3, enhancing its utilization and effectiveness. Impact on Immune Function and Disease Prevention

Vitamin D3 is integral to modulating immune responses, reducing the risk of infections, and supporting the body's defense mechanisms. Studies have demonstrated that adequate vitamin D3 levels can enhance innate immunity—the body's first line of defense—by stimulating the production of antimicrobial peptides like cathelicidins and defensins. These peptides help combat bacterial, viral, and fungal pathogens, reducing the incidence and severity of infections, especially respiratory illnesses.

Moreover, vitamin D3's immunomodulatory effects are critical in autoimmune disorders. It can temper overactive immune responses, decreasing chronic inflammation—a hallmark of aging. Since many age-related diseases involve inflammatory pathways, maintaining optimal vitamin D3 status might reduce the risk of developing conditions such as rheumatoid arthritis, multiple sclerosis, and other autoimmune diseases.

Role in Reducing Inflammation and Oxidative Stress

Chronic low-grade inflammation is linked to aging and the development of numerous age-associated diseases like cardiovascular disease, neurodegeneration, and metabolic syndrome. Vitamin D3 has demonstrated anti-inflammatory properties by decreasing pro-inflammatory cytokines and promoting anti-inflammatory agents. Additionally, it acts as an antioxidant, reducing oxidative stress—a process that damages DNA, proteins, and lipids, accelerating cellular aging.

Enhancement of Cellular Repair and Regeneration Processes

At a cellular level, vitamin D3 influences gene expression linked to cell proliferation, differentiation, and apoptosis—the programmed cell death vital for tissue homeostasis. It is involved in stimulating stem cell activity and promoting regeneration, especially in skin and tissues vulnerable to aging. By supporting these processes, vitamin D3 contributes to maintaining tissue integrity and repairing damage, which are essential for aging gracefully.

Protection Against Age-Related Chronic Diseases

Multiple epidemiological studies suggest that sufficient vitamin D3 levels are associated with lower risks of developing chronic illnesses such as cardiovascular disease, neurodegenerative disorders like Alzheimer’s, and certain cancers. For example, vitamin D3 influences endothelial function, reduces arterial stiffness, and modulates neuroinflammation—all factors linked to cardiovascular health and neurodegeneration. Similarly, its role in cell cycle regulation may inhibit tumor growth, contributing to cancer prevention strategies.

Supporting Skin Health and Youthful Appearance

Beyond internal health benefits, vitamin D3 plays a role in skin renewal and elasticity. It is involved in collagen production and cell turnover, which are essential for maintaining a youthful appearance. Some studies suggest that maintaining adequate vitamin D3 levels can help reduce signs of aging skin, such as wrinkles and loss of elasticity, contributing to a more vibrant, younger-looking complexion.

Vitamin D3 Supplementation Strategies: Maximizing Benefits Safely and Effectively

Implementing a successful vitamin D3 supplementation plan requires a nuanced understanding of individual needs and careful considerations to maximize benefits while minimizing risks.

Understanding Optimal Dosing

Dosing should be personalized based on age, geographic location, skin pigmentation, lifestyle, existing health conditions, and baseline vitamin D levels. For most adults, a daily dose of 800 to 2,000 IU can maintain sufficiency. However, some individuals, especially those with limited sun exposure or darker skin, may require higher doses—up to 4,000 IU daily—under medical supervision. Periodic blood testing ensures the dosage maintains optimal serum levels without exceeding safety thresholds.

Timing and Frequency of Supplementation

Consistency is key. Daily supplementation tends to result in stable blood levels, but weekly or monthly mega-doses are also used under clinical guidance. Taking vitamin D3 with a meal containing fat improves absorption, as it is a fat-soluble vitamin. Regular intake aligned with healthcare advice helps sustain steady serum levels conducive to long-term health benefits.

Synergistic Nutrients and Their Role

Combining vitamin D3 with vitamin K2 enhances calcium metabolism, directing calcium to bones and preventing vascular calcification. Magnesium is also essential for activating vitamin D3 and enhancing its biological functions. Incorporating these nutrients through supplements or diet can amplify health benefits and provide a comprehensive approach to aging support. Monitoring and Safety Considerations

Regular blood testing (25(OH)D levels) is crucial to avoid toxicity, which, although rare, can cause hypercalcemia and associated complications. Over-supplementation beyond 4000 IU daily, especially over prolonged periods, should be avoided unless directed by a healthcare provider. Signs of excess include nausea, fatigue, and digestive issues. Therefore, consulting with a healthcare professional for personalized dosing and periodic monitoring ensures safe, effective vitamin D3 supplementation.

Vitamin D3 Metabolism: How Your Body Processes and Utilizes It for Anti-Aging

Understanding the journey of vitamin D3 through your body reveals the complexity and importance of its metabolism. Synthesis begins when UVB rays convert 7-dehydrocholesterol in the skin into previtamin D3, which is then isomerized into vitamin D3 (cholecalciferol). Dietary sources, such as fatty fish or fortified foods, provide an additional intake route. Once in circulation, vitamin D3 undergoes activation through a two-step hydroxylation process involving the liver and kidneys.

In the liver, vitamin D3 is hydroxylated by enzymes like CYP2R1 to form 25-hydroxyvitamin D (calcidiol), the main circulating form used to assess vitamin D status. This form then undergoes a second hydroxylation primarily in the kidneys, converting it into 1,25-dihydroxyvitamin D (calcitriol), the active hormonal form. Calcitriol regulates calcium and phosphate absorption, gene expression, and cellular differentiation—all vital processes in maintaining health and tissue integrity.

Several factors influence this metabolism including genetic variations in hydroxylation enzymes, age-related decline in renal function, obesity (which can sequester vitamin D in fat tissues), and medical conditions like liver or kidney disease. Impaired metabolism can lead to suboptimal activation of vitamin D3, undermining its intended health benefits and potentially accelerating age-related decline.

Maintaining efficient metabolism involves ensuring adequate substrate availability (sufficient vitamin D3 levels), supporting liver and kidney health, and considering the use of supportive nutrients like magnesium. Recognizing these factors enables a more precise and effective approach to optimizing vitamin D3’s anti-aging properties.

Signs of Vitamin D3 Deficiency: Recognizing When You Need Supplementation

Vitamin D3 deficiency can manifest subtly, often being overlooked until more serious health issues arise. Common signs include persistent fatigue, bone pain, muscle weakness, and mood disturbances such as depression or increased anxiety. These symptoms are nonspecific but can indicate inadequate vitamin D levels, especially when coupled with risk factors like limited sun exposure or darker skin pigmentation.

Individuals with autoimmune conditions or repeated infections may also exhibit deficiency symptoms due to impaired immune support. Risk factors include geographic location (north latitudes with less sunlight), indoor lifestyles, obesity, malabsorption syndromes, and certain medical conditions like chronic kidney or liver disease.

Furthermore, deficiency accelerates the aging process by impairing calcium absorption (leading to weaker bones), reducing cellular repair efficiency, and increasing inflammation. Since these processes underlie many age-related diseases, it’s crucial to identify deficiency early.

The most reliable way to determine vitamin D status is through a blood test measuring serum 25(OH)D levels. Routine screening is advisable for at-risk populations, ensuring timely supplementation and optimal health management.

Vitamin D3 and Bone Health: Building Strong Foundations for Aging Gracefully

One of the most well-established roles of vitamin D3 is facilitating calcium absorption in the intestines, essential for bone mineralization. Adequate vitamin D3 levels help maintain bone density, reduce fracture risk, and prevent conditions like osteoporosis—a common concern among aging populations.

Vitamin D3 promotes the synthesis of osteocalcin and collagen, proteins critical for bone matrix formation. Its deficiency leads to decreased calcium absorption, secondary hyperparathyroidism, and increased bone resorption, all culminating in weakened bones and heightened fracture risk.

Research indicates that maintaining sufficient vitamin D3 levels, particularly when combined with calcium and other nutrients, significantly improves bone health. For example, supplementation with vitamin D3 has been shown to reduce the incidence of hip fractures in elderly populations. What are the main benefits of Vitamin D3 for anti-aging?

Vitamin D3 supports immune function, reduces inflammation, promotes cellular repair, maintains bone health, and may lower the risk of chronic age-related diseases such as cardiovascular issues and neurodegeneration. These combined effects help slow the aging process and improve quality of life.

How do I know if I need a Vitamin D3 supplement?

If you experience symptoms like fatigue, bone or muscle pain, or mood changes, and have risk factors such as limited sun exposure or darker skin, a blood test measuring serum 25(OH)D can confirm deficiency. Regular monitoring is recommended to adjust dosage effectively.

What is the safe upper limit for Vitamin D3 intake?

The generally recognized safe upper limit is 4,000 IU daily for most adults. Doses higher than this should only be taken under medical supervision, as excessive intake can lead to toxicity and health complications.

Can Vitamin D3 be combined with other nutrients?

Yes, combining vitamin D3 with nutrients like vitamin K2, magnesium, and omega-3 fatty acids can enhance its benefits. For example, vitamin K2 directs calcium to bones and away from arteries, while magnesium activates vitamin D3.
